'Hearth and Fire'
~ Gordon Bok (1984)

"Hearth and fire be ours tonight
And all the dark outside,
Fair the night, and kind on you
Wherever you may bide.

And I'll be the sun upon your head,
The wind about your face;
My love upon the path you tread
And upon your wanderings, peace.

Wine and song be ours tonight,
And all the cold outside;
Peace and warmth be yours tonight
Wherever you may bide.

Hearth and fire be ours tonight
And the wind in the birches bare;
Oh, that the wind we hear tonight,
Would find you well and fair."


(from the very talented Gordon Bok at www.gordonbok.com)
